Business Analyst

2 weeks ago


Centurion South Africa SpesNet Group Full time

Essential Job Functions: A Business Analyst at MediCharge assumes a multifaceted role encompassing diverse responsibilities spanning across business analysis, product specification, and documentation. The following key tasks are integral to the position: Business Requirements Gathering and Analysis: Collaborate with stakeholders, including end-users, business leaders, and technical teams, to define business needs and desired outcomes. Conduct thorough research and analyze data to uncover improvement opportunities and inform system requirements. Translate business needs and desired outcomes into a Business Requirement Specification (BRS) or functional specifications and User Stories (with assumptions and acceptance criteria) that are well-defined, testable and achievable. Develop and conduct peer reviews of the business requirements to ensure that requirement specifications are correctly interpreted. Apply Agile methodologies (e.g., backlog refinement, sprint planning) to translate business requirements into actionable user stories and acceptance criteria. Maintain and prioritize the product backlog, ensuring that it reflects the most valuable and actionable items. Apply data-driven insights and process modeling to identify opportunities for workflow automation or optimization. Communication, Collaboration and Documentation: Act as a liaison between business stakeholders and project teams, ensuring clear and consistent communication throughout the project lifecycle. Review approved client requirements and product specifications with the development and testing team and address queries. Effectively communicates insights and plans to cross-functional team members and management. Collaborate with the development and testing team to create and refine comprehensive documentation, including user stories, flowcharts, process flows and technical specifications (where needed), that effectively communicate requirements. Present findings and recommendations to stakeholders in a clear and concise manner and address any questions or concerns raised. Create process models, specifications, and diagrams to provide direction to developers, testers and/or the project team. Write and maintaining user stories and acceptance criteria and defining the Definition of Done (DoD) for user stories. Validate product specifications with clients and stakeholders. Use collaboration tools such as Jira, Teams, SharePoint and Bizagi for documentation and visualization. Ensure that documentation and communication align with Agile ceremonies and change management processes. Facilitate workshops and feedback sessions to ensure continuous alignment. General: Participate in Agile ceremonies (retrospectives, sprint reviews). Support data validation and integration testing during UAT. Ensure alignment between business requirements and implemented solutions. Work collaboratively with the Project Manager to develop and update project plans, timelines, and estimates. Maintain and update project documentation as needed. During Pilot, provide training and support to end-users, on functionality or projects. This may involve updating training materials as well as conducting training sessions. Handle client queries during Pilot and Roll-out phase and refer errors to testing team. Monitor system performance and user feedback during go-live and post-deployment to recommend improvements. Skills, experience, and functional requirements: A bachelor’s degree or diploma in Business Analysis or related field. At least 2 years’ experience in business or system analysis (Healthcare experience advantages). Exceptional analytical, conceptual thinking and problem-solving skills, with a keen eye for detail. Excellent collaboration, interpersonal, listening, and communication skills. The ability to influence stakeholders and work closely with them to determine acceptable solutions. Proficiency in Microsoft Office Suite (Excel, Word, PowerPoint) and project management tools (MS Project and Jira - preferable). Experience with data analysis and visualization techniques and tools. Microsoft Access and/or SQL experience will be advantageous. NOTE: This job description is not an exhaustive list of duties, and the successful candidate may be required to perform other tasks as assigned.


  • It Business Analyst

    6 days ago


    South Africa Boardroom Appointments Full time R1 000 000 - R2 500 000 per year

    Key purpose:Our company is currently on the hunt to acquire an IT Business Analyst. The role will be based in Randfontein and report to the Applications Manager.Duties and responsibilities:Ensures that all tests are conducted and documented according to the standards agreed upon by the business unit and IT.Responsible for ensuring that all documentation...

  • Business Analyst

    6 days ago


    Sandton, South Africa Calibrate People Full time R60 000 - R120 000 per year

    Business AnalystAre you the Change Maestro and Process Whisperer we have been dreaming about?Location: Sandton, Johannesburg, SA - Hybrid | Salary:Competitive (Cause you're worth it)What's the Gig?Data is your playground, and insights are your superpower. Were on the lookout for a Business Analyst with a knack for translating raw numbers into game-changing...


  • South Africa Moyo Africa Consulting Full time R2 000 000 - R2 500 000 per year

    WELCOME TO MOYOSenior Business Analyst – MiningThe Senior Business Analyst plays a critical role in analysing, optimising, and implementing business and operational systems within a mining environment. The role focuses on ensuring that mining operations, production systems, and supporting business processes are fully understood, effectively digitised, and...


  • South Africa Inspired Testing Full time

    Role: Business Analyst (with strong testing exposure)Type: Independent ContractStart: November months, with potential to extend)Location: Remote, anywhere in South Africa, delivering to a European clientSummaryWe're adding two BAs to support a busy test organisation delivering digital banking capabilities. The BA(s) will free up senior test analysts and...

  • Business Analyst

    3 days ago


    Pretoria, South Africa Profession Hub Full time

    Our client is searching for a Business Analyst to join their team in Pretoria - Hybrid (2-3 days a week at the office)   Job Purpose:  To analyse business needs, define system requirements, and translate them into effective solutions that improve business processes and support system redevelopment initiatives. The role involves working on system...

  • Business Analyst

    6 days ago


    Sandton, South Africa Boardroom Appointments Full time R900 000 - R1 200 000 per year

    Business Analyst - 12 Month ContractRequirements:Apply a set of tasks and techniques to act as a liaison among stakeholders.Understand the problems, opportunities, needs, structure, policies, and operations of the organization.Work on large, high-risk, and complex projects.Recommend solutions that enable the organization to achieve its goals.Elicit and...

  • Business Analyst

    1 week ago


    Johannesburg, South Africa LINKFIELDS INNOVATIONS (PTY) LTD Full time

    Job descriptionThe Business Analyst is responsible for bridging the gap between business stakeholders and technical teams by gathering, analysing, and documenting business requirements. This role ensures that business needs are clearly understood, solutions are well-defined, and projects deliver measurable value. Responsibilities and DutiesBusiness Analysis...


  • Cape Town, South Africa iOCO Pty Ltd Full time

    The Senior Business Analyst will serve as a key liaison between business stakeholders and technical teams to ensure the successful delivery of complex solutions at iOCO. This role involves documenting requirements, analyzing business processes, facilitating workshops, and supporting the design and implementation of automated solutions. The Senior Business...


  • Johannesburg, South Africa iDbase Software Full time

    About the Role We are seeking a highly skilled Senior Business Analyst to work across complex, multi-domain environments within FinTech / Insurance / retirement investment platforms. You will play a critical role in gathering and translating business requirements, optimizing processes, supporting regulatory and compliance initiatives, and ensuring technology...

  • Business Analyst

    6 days ago


    South Africa Equal Experts Full time R100 000 - R1 200 000 per year

    DescriptionEqual Experts is an innovative consultancy specialising in the delivery of custom software solutions for blue-chip enterprise and public sector clients across a range of industry sectors. We work on important projects for our clients, deliver market-leading propositions across the digital, online and mobile channels, and are recognised for our...